ATLAS North America Proprietary
Sea Scan ARC Scout MKII Operations Manual
1 of 1
Page: 30
Issue: 1.2.4
SCTM2-OPS
Operations Manual
Data Name
Variable Name
Units
Value Range
Description
Example Value
1- Voltage alarm
has been flagged
Slave Unit's Alarm
Current High Flag
ihi
N/A
0 or 1
0 - No current
alarm
1- Current alarm
has been flagged
0
Slave Unit's Alarm
Temperature High
Flag
thi
N/A
0 or 1
0 - No temperature
alarm
1- Temperature
alarm has been
flagged
0
The Main Page contains Javascript code that makes requests for status.json once per second. It uses
Javascripts XMLHttpRequest object to do the heavy lifting. Upon receipt of the status.json data the
Javascript code uses the JSON object to parse the JSON data into a Javascript object that can easily be used
to dynamically update the status on the Main Page. For more information please read the index.html
source code located on the Scout MkII. For parsing a JSON data file in C or C++ we recommend using one of
the many libraries written such as JSMN (located at http://zserge.bitbucket.org/jsmn.html).
5.5
Firmware Update
Updating the firmware is accomplished through the update.html web page. To update the firmware load
the update.html web page. The Update Firmware Step 1 web page will appear as shown below.
Click on the
Browse
button.